Rebecchini Earns Three-Set Victory as NSU Falls To Howard 6-1

Cary, N.C. – Howard defeated Norfolk State 7-0 on the second afternoon of the MEAC Tennis Roundup at Cary Tennis Park on Friday. Federico Rebecchini received the Spartans only win of the day, coming out on top of a three-set battle at the No. 1 singles position.
 
Rebecchini won the opening set 6-4 against Howard's Justin Cadeau, but Cadeau fought back to win the second 7-6 by taking the tiebreak 8-6. The pair played a third set tiebreak to decide the match, with Rebecchini escaping with an 8-10 victory.
 
Rebechinni and Hugo Massoni Lena won 6-4 at the No. 1 doubles slot, but the Bison took the doubles point by winning the other two matches. Massoni Lena eventually lost 6-2,6-1 to Howard's Marcel Dawson at No. 2 singles.
 
Howard won the No. 6 slot by default, and NSU freshmen Roosevelt Brown III and Jeremiah Zellander lost 6-0, 6-0 at positions No. 4 and No. 5, respectively. The Bison won on Court 3 as well, as Daniel Duncac defeated Ibrahim Abbas 6-0, 6-2.
 
NSU falls to 0-5 with the loss, 0-2 in the MEAC. The Spartans will remain in Cary, N.C. for one more match as part of the MEAC Tennis Roundup, facing Coppin State on Saturday at 3 p.m.
